#200933 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#200933 is composed of 12.5% red, 3.5%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.3% cyan, 82.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 80% black. It has a hue angle of 272.9 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 11.8%. #200933 color hex could be obtained by blending #401266 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

● #200933 color description : Very dark violet.
#200933 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#200933 has RGB values of R:32, G:9,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 2099507.

Shades and Tints of #200933
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f6effc is the lightest one.

Tones of #200933
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1e1e1e is the less saturated color, while #21023a is the most saturated one.
